Oral-Maxillofacial Surgery and Pathology is the dental specialty that focuses on the diagnosis, surgical and adjunctive treatment of diseases, injuries and defects involving the functional and esthetic aspects of hard and soft tissues of the oral-maxillofacial and facial regions. This includes a wide spectrum of problems and solutions including oral and facial infections, impacted teeth, dental implants, jaw and facial trauma, jaw under or over development, mouth and jaw cysts and tumors, cleft palates, jaw reconstruction, advanced forms of conscious sedation, and temporomandibular joint problems. The faculty provides educational training to students and other practitioners in these areas as well care for private patients.
